Item 4.01 Changes in Registrant’s Certifying Accountant.

(a) Resignation of independent registered public accounting firm.

UHY LLP (“UHY”) served as the independent registered public accounting firm of Furmanite Corporation (the “Company”) to audit the financial statements and internal control over financial reporting of the Company for the fiscal years ended December 31, 2013 and 2012. The Audit Committee of the Company’s Board of Directors (the “Audit Committee”) selected UHY to serve as the Company’s independ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2014, which was ratified by shareholders in May 2014. On December 1, 2014, UHY informed the Company that effective on that date, its Texas practice had been acquired by BDO USA, LLP (“BDO”). As a result of this transaction, on December 1, 2014, UHY resigned as the Company’s independ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2014.
The audit reports of UHY on the Company’s consolidated financial statements for the years ended December 31, 2013 and 2012 did not contain an adverse opinion or disclaimer of opinion, and these statements were not qualified or modified as to uncertainty, audit scope or accounting principles.
During the fiscal years ended December 31, 2013 and 2012, and the subsequent interim period through December 1, 2014, there were no disagreements with UHY on any matter of accounting principles or practices, financial statement disclosure or auditing scope or procedure, which disagreement, had it not been resolved to the satisfaction of UHY, would have caused UHY to make reference thereto in its reports on the financial statements for such periods. During this time, there have been no “reportable events,” as that term is described in Item 304(a)(1)(v) of Regulation S-K.
The Company has requested that UHY furnish it with a letter addressed to the Securities and Exchange Commission stating whether UHY agrees with the above statements. A copy of such letter dated December 2, 2014, is filed as Exhibit 16.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K.

(b) Engagement of new independent registered public accounting firm.

As a result of the transaction discussed above, the Audit Committee appointed BDO as the successor independent registered public accounting firm on December 3, 2014. Prior to such appointment, the Company had not consulted with BDO with respect to the application of accounting principles to a specified transaction, either completed or proposed, or the type of audit opinion that might be rendered on the Company’s consolidated financial statements, or any other matter or reportable events listed in Items 304(a)(2)(i) and (ii) of Regulation S-K.
